Installation and Maintenance Guidelines
Installation: Remove the grate from catch basin. If using optional oil
absorbents; place absorbent pillow in unit. Stand the grate on end.
Move the top lifting straps out of 11% way and place the grate into the
Dandy Bag II so that the grate is below the top straps and above the
lower straps. Holding the lifting devices, insert the grate into the inlet.
Maintenance: Remove all accumulated sediment and debris from vicinity
Of unit after each storm event. After each storm event and at regular
intervals, look into the Dandy Bag ll. if the containment area is more
than 1/3 full of sediment, the unit must be emptied. To empty unit,
lift the unit out of the inlet using the lifting straps and remove the
grate. If using optional oil absorbents; replace absorbent who
saturation. R= 1I

CONSTRUCTION SEQUENCE
1. NOTIFY IDEM AND HAMILTON COUNTY SWCD WITHIN 48 HOURS
OF COMMENCING WORK.
2. POST THE N01 AND CONTACT INFORMATION OF THE PERSON
ONSITE RESPONSIBLE FOR RULE 5.
3. APPOINT A PERSON TO BE RESPONSIBLE FOR THE WEEKLY
AND AFTER EACH 1/2" RAINFALL SITE EVALUATIONS.
4. INSTALL TEMPORARY CONSTRUCTION ENTRANCE, SILT FENCE.
5. INSTALL INLET PROTECTION.
6. INSTALL WHEEL WASH AND CONCRETE WASHOUT.
7. INSTALL SHORING & EXCAVATE FOR LOWER LEVEL THEATER.
B. INSTALL UTILITIES AND STORM SEWERS.
9. BUILDING CONSTRUCTION AND BACKFILL EXCAVATION.
10. TEMPORARY SEED ROUGH GRADE BACKFILL.
11. FINAL GRADING AND PAVING.
12. REMOVE TEMPORARY EROSION CONTROL MEASURES
AFTER EXPOSED SOIL IS STABILIZED BY SODDING
MULCHING.

THE BEST WAY TO AVOID RUNOFF CONTAMINATION FROM SPILLED MATERIALS IS TO PREVENT
4. OUR PLANS DETAIL A BMP CHOSEN FOR THEIR PROVEN ABILITY
THE SPILL FROM OCCURRING. CAREFUL STORAGE OF MATERIALS IN SOUND, CLEARLY LABELED
TO REMOVE DEBRIS AND OILS FROM THE STORMINATER RUNOFF.
CONTAINERS AND REGULAR INSPECTION AND MAINTENANCE OF EQUIPMENT ARE KEY PRACTICES
TO PREVENT SPILLS. MATERIALS STORED OUTSIDE SHOULD BE COVERED AND KEPT ON A
5. THE PEDCOR DEVELOPERS HAVE DEMONSTRATED THEIR DESIRE TO MAINTAIN
PAVED AREA TO PROTECT THEM FROM BEING MOBILIZED BY WIND AND RUNOFF. IF NOT
THEIR DEVELOPMENT INA MANNER CONSISTENT WITH THEIR IMAGE AND SERVICE
ROOFED, THE STORAGE AREA SHOULD BE DESIGNED TO DRAIN WITH A SLIGHT SLOPE
TO THE COMMUNITY. PAVED AREAS ARE KEPT SWEPT, LAWN TRIMMINGS
(APPROXIMATELY 1.5 PERCENT) TO AN AREA THAT WILL PROVIDE TREATMENT PRIOR TO
AND FALLEN LEAVES ARE PROMPTLY REMOVED FROM THE SITE. THE
STAFF WILL BE MADE AWARE THAT THE SEPARATORS NEED TO BE
DISPOSAL RUNOFF FROM OTHER AREAS SHOULD BE EXCLUDED TO REDUCE THE VOLUME OF
INSPECTED, WITH THE ACCUMULATED DEBRIS REMOVED WHEN NECESSARY.
RUNOFF REQUIRING TREATMENT BY INSTALLING BERMS, CURBS OR DIVERSIONS ON THE
PERIMETER OF THE STORAGE AREA. SECONDARY CONTAINMENT SHOULD BE USED WHEN
LIQUIDS ARE STORED AND RUNOFF OR SPILLS FROM THE CONTAINMENT AREA SHOULD BE
DIRECTED TO THE SANITARY SEWER WHERE PERMISSIBLE OR TO AN APPROPRIATE STORAGE OR
TREATMENT FACILITY FOR REUSE OR DISPOSAL PROCEDURES SHOULD COVER SMALL, EASY
TO HANDLE SPILLS AS WELL AS LARGE SPILLS THAT REQUIRE EMPLOYEES TO CONTACT
EMERGENCY PERSONNEL. THE PROCEDURES SHOULD EMPHASIZE THAT SPILLS MUST BE
CLEANED UP PROMPTLY AND SHOULD SPECIFY HOW EACH TYPE OF MATERIAL SHOULD BE
HANDLED. THE USE OF WATER FOR CLEANUP SHOULD BE STRONGLY DISCOURAGED. SHOP
RAGS SHOULD BE USED FOR SMALL SPILLS OF NONVOLATILE CHEMICALS AND USED RAGS
SHOULD BE SENT TO A PROFESSIONAL CLEANING SERVICE TO PREVENT THEM FROM CAUSING
A POLLUTION PROBLEM IN A LANDFILL OR OTHER DISPOSAL AREA. LARGER SPILLS SHOULD
BE ABSORBED WITH VERMICULITE, SAWDUST, KITTY LiTTER OR ABSORBENT "SNAKES."
DISPOSAL METHODS DEPEND ON THE HAZARD LEVEL OF THE SPILLED MATERIAL NONVOLATILE
LIQUIDS CAN BE CLEANED UP WITH A WET/DRY SHOP VACUUM AND DISPOSED OF WITH THE
REST OF THE FACILITY'S WASTE. DRAINS OR INLETS TO STORM SEWERS SHOULD BE
PLUGGED DURING SPILL REMEDIATION TO PREVENT OFF SITE EXPORT OF POLLUTANTS.

TEMPORARY SEEDING:
KIND OF SEED 1000 SQ.Fr. ACRE REMARKS
WHEAT OR RYE 3.5 LBS. 2 BU. COVER SEED 1" TO 1-1/2" DEEP
SPRING OATS 2.3 LBS. 3 BU. COVER SEED TO 1 DEEP
ANNUAL RYEGRASS 1 LB. 40 LBS. COVER SEED TO 1/4- DEEP
MULCH 1.5-2 TON ACRES
* NOT NECESSARY WHERE MULCH IS APPLIED.
IF A SITE IS GOING TO BE UNDISTURBED FOR 15 DAYS OR
MORE THEN TEMPORARY SEED WILL NEED TO BE INSTALLED.
IF AT ANYTIME THE SEEDING CANNOT BE ESTABLISHED. THEN
A MULCH OR SOME OTHER APPROVED GROUND STABILIZER
WILL HAVE TO BE INSTALLED, PER APPROVAL OF THE STORM
WATER CONSERVATION DEPARTMENT.

EROSION CONTROL NOTES:
1. ALL EROSION AND SEDIMENT CONTROL WORK SHALL
CONFORM TO THE STANDARDS, SPECIFICATIONS AND
PROCEDURES OF THE CITY, COUNTY, OR OTHER GOVERNING
AGENCIES, WHICHEVER HAS JURISDICTION.
2. SOIL EROSION CONTROL DEVICES AND PRACTICES WILL BE
ESTABLISHED IMMEDIATELY BEFORE ANY CLEARING, GRADING,
EXCAVATING, FILLING OR OTHER DISTURBANCE OF NATURAL
TERRAIN. THE SITE WAS JUST RECENTLY CLEARED AND
NO NATURAL VEGETATION REMAINS.
3. ALL EROSION AND SEDIMENT CONTROL DEVICES SHALL
REMAIN IN PLACE DURING THE ENTIRE CONSTRUCTION PHASE.
ONLY THOSE CONTROLS AND DEVICES THAT ARE TEMPORARY
IN NATURE SHALL BE REMOVED OR MODIFIED TO ALLOW
PROGRESS OF CONSTRUCTION. DAILY INSPECTIONS MUST BE
MADE BY THE CONTRACTOR FOR EFFECTIVENESS OF THE
EROSION AND SEDIMENT CONTROL DEVICES. NECESSARY
REPAIRS OR REPLACEMENT MUST BE MADE WITHOUT DELAY.
THE CONTRACTOR SHALL BE RESPONSIBLE FOR THE CARE,
MAINTENANCE REPAIR AND RECONSTRUCTION OF ALL DEVICES,
CONTROLS AND ERODED AREAS. IF THE CONTRACT IS GIVEN
TO THE EXCAVATING CONTRACTOR OR A SUBCONTRACTOR AND
THEY FAIL TO MAINTAIN AND REPAIR ALL DAMAGE TO THE
EROSION CONTROL DEVICES, THEN THE GENERAL CONTRACTOR
WILL BE RESPONSIBLE FOR THIS WORK AND ANY DAMAGE
THAT MAY HAVE OCCURRED.
5. STRAW BALES, SILT FENCING AND OR GRAVEL PROTECTION
SHALL BE USED AS INDICATED ON PLANS. IF LOCAL
ORDINANCES DICTATE ALTERNATE EROSION CONTROL DEVICES
AND DETAILS, IT SHALL BE THE RESPONSIBILITY OF THE
CONTRACTOR TO USE THE REQUIRED LOCAL DEVICES.
6. ALL MUD, DIRT OR GRAVEL SPILLED, TRACKED OR DUMPED
ON PUBLIC OR PRIVATE STREETS, ROADS, DRIVEWAYS OR
SIDEWALKS, MUST BE REMOVED PROMPTLY BY THE
CONTRACTOR.
7. NO 100 -YEAR FLOODPLANS, FLOODWAY FRINGES OR
FLOODWAYS EXIST ON THE SITE.
8. IT IS NOT ANTICIPATED THAT STORM WATER WILL ENTER
GROUND WATER ON THE SITE.
9. THE CONTRACTOR SHALL HAVE THE TRASH PICKED UP
ON A DAILY ROUTINE DURING CONSTRUCTION.
10. THE CONTRACTOR SHALL PROVIDE A CONCRETE WASH-OUT AREA
ROUGHLY 1OX10 OR 15 X15 AND 2 FEET DEEP. THE CONTRACTOR
SHALL DISPOSE OF THE CONCRETE WASHOUT MATERIAL IN A MANNER
APPROPRIATE TO STATE LAWS THAT GOVERN INDIANA.
11. THE FUELING AND TOP OFF OF VEHICLES AND EQUIPMENT SHALL
BE DONE IN A DESIGNATED AREA WHERE THE FUEL THAT MAY SPILL
IS COLLECTED AND DISPOSED OF IN A APPROPRIATE MANNER
ACCORDING TO STATE LAWS THAT GOVERN INDIANA.
